摘要:Silica nanoparticles were linked by using 3-mercaptopropyltrimethoxysilane (MPS) as a coupling agent and Cd2+ as bridging ions. The TEM micrographs showed approximately linear linkage between the silica nanoparticles rather than dense packing. The UV-visible absorption spectra confirmed the formation of S-Cd-S bonds between the silica nanoparticles. The alternative films of MPS-modified SiO2 nanoparticles and Cd2+ ions were also prepared using the layer-by-layer self-assembly technique and characterized by AFM. Copyright ?
